Product overview
This module provides comprehensive guidance on the installation, maintenance, and operation of the IVR v.4 service. It includes a detailed summary of the entire end-to-end workflow for using IVR v.4.

The IVR4 is an advanced solution designed to bridge the gap between vulnerability detection and remediation actions, significantly improving the speed, accuracy, and efficiency of addressing security vulnerabilities. By integrating with Tenable's vulnerability data and BigFix's remediation capabilities, IVR provides a streamlined approach to help organizations rapidly address security risks.
Key features of the IVR v.4 system include:
-
Improved Vulnerability to Remediation Correlation:
Traditionally, the correlation between Tenable's
vulnerability findings and BigFix's remediation content was
based on CVE IDs (Common Vulnerabilities and Exposures),
which often resulted in delays and inaccuracies. With the new approach,
IVR4 uses a rule-based system that leverages various
Tenable plugin attributes, such as the
xreftype for more precise correlation. Moreover, IVR4 now provides a pre-correlated mapping between Tenable plugins and BigFix Fixlets, updated continuously.This enhancement leads to faster and more accurate remediation guidance.
-
Enhanced Asset Correlation: Previously,
Tenable assets were matched to devices in
BigFix based on IP addresses, MAC addresses, or
hostnames. This method often results in issues due to changing IP addresses or
devices with multiple network adapters. With the new release,
IVR4 can directly leverage the
BigFix Asset IDprovided by Tenable, improving the accuracy and speed of asset correlation.This new method eliminates challenges associated with virtualization and devices that have dynamic or multiple network connections.
-
Reduced Infrastructure Requirements: One of the
significant challenges with previous versions of IVR was the
need for substantial infrastructure, particularly in larger environments.
Customers needed to deploy and maintain both the BigFix
Insights component and the IVR Service,
which involved additional SQL databases, ETL configurations, and resource
management. With the new IVR4 architecture, the
IVR service is now decoupled from BigFix
Insights entirely, simplifying the deployment process and
reducing the overall infrastructure footprint.
This means faster time-to-value for customers, as well as reduced resource requirements, improved timeliness of data, and lower operational costs.
